Transaction 666a78aa20a34f1d3ef7fb79a3c2d706e9f3f4a022fae0ea83e4561a42c7854e

34 Input
1 Outputs
  • 666a78aa20a34f1d3ef7fb79a3c2d706e9f3f4a022fae0ea83e4561a42c7854e:0
  • value  363488585
    address  3Ke1yqUMRW1SKRVXVrsysdAQKN6AVf7pwp